Simple and rapid validated HPLC-fluorescence determination of perampanel in the plasma of patients with epilepsy

We present a simple and fast high-performance liquid chromatography method with fluorescence detection for the determination of the antiepileptic drug perampanel in human plasma. The chromatographic separation was performed on a Kinetex PFP (100 × 2.6mm, 4.6μm) column, using a mobile phase of sodium acetate 0.03MpH 3.7 and acetonitrile (40/60, v/v), at a flow rate of 0.8mL/min. Total chromatography time for each run was 5min. Sample preparation (250μL) involved only one simple precipitation step by acetonitrile spiked with mirtazapine as internal standard. The method was validated over a concentration range of 20–1000ng/mL and successfully applied to measure perampanel concentrations in plasma samples obtained from patients with epilepsy. This assay combines the high specificity of fluorescence detection with a very simple and fast sample pretreatment and can offer real advantages over existing methods in terms of simplicity and transferability to a therapeutic drug monitoring setting. Highlights ? A very simple assay for the determination of perampanel in human plasma is proposed. ? The analysis is based on HPLC-F coupled with an only deproteinization step. ? No time consuming liquid-liquid extractions and evaporations are required. ? This assay significantly simplifies existing ones in terms of transferability to TDM.
